Astroid 3.3.13 Released – UX Improvements, Mega Menu Fixes, and New Layout Controls

We’re excited to announce the release of Astroid Framework 3.3.13. This update focuses on improving menu usability, touch-device compatibility, and overall UI/UX, while also introducing new layout features and updating several core libraries.

Our team has also addressed a number of issues related to Mega Menu behavior, accessibility attributes, and GSAP integration, ensuring a smoother experience across devices.


Highlights

Better Mega Menu Experience on Touch Devices

Navigation on touch screens has been significantly improved. Several issues affecting menu interaction have been resolved, including problems where users could not click top-level menu links or select submenu items. The Mega Menu logic has also been refined to provide a more intuitive experience for mobile and tablet users.

Improved Accessibility and Menu Behavior

We fixed broken ARIA attributes in submenu elements to improve accessibility and standards compliance. Additionally, the submenu interface has been refined to enhance usability and prevent unexpected behavior when submenu content is empty.

New Layout Controls

A new Section Height and Column Height feature has been added, giving developers more flexibility when designing layouts and controlling vertical alignment within sections.

More Control Over Animations

A new option allows developers to enable or disable the Stagger animation effect, providing greater control over animation performance and visual style.

Updated Core Libraries

Several important libraries have been updated to ensure compatibility, stability, and new features:

  • Font Awesome: 7.0.0 → 7.2.0
  • LenisJS: 1.3.8 → 1.3.18
  • Fancybox: 6.0 → 6.1

Bug Fixes and Stability Improvements

This release also resolves a number of smaller issues, including:

  • Fixed error where GSAP plugins could not be loaded
  • Fixed deprecated notice for null index in Row Class array
  • Fixed issue selecting the wrong logo in Dark Mode
  • Improved Mega Menu smart positioning
  • Improved behavior when submenu content is empty

Astroid Framework 3.3.12 Released

We’re excited to announce the release of Astroid Framework 3.3.12, bringing a series of improvements to the Mega Menu system, fixes for background video functionality, and better interaction handling on hybrid devices.

This update focuses on refining the navigation experience and giving developers and site builders more control over Mega Menu animations and behavior, while also fixing a few issues reported by the community.

Special thanks to @joomlaplates-de, @WM-Loose, @Giorgi625, @rinka88 and @matrix630307 for their valuable support in bringing this version to life.


✨ New Features & Improvements

Mega Menu Enhancements

Navigation continues to be a core part of the Astroid experience. In this release, we’ve expanded the Mega Menu capabilities with new visual effects and configuration options.

  1. New Mega Menu dropdown effects
    You can now choose from several animation styles to better match your site’s design and user experience:
  • Fade
  • Zoom
  • Slide
  • Drop
  • Flip
  • ScaleY
  • Blur-in
  • Slide-scale
  • None
  1. Mega Menu Backdrop toggle
    A new option allows you to enable or disable the Mega Menu backdrop, giving you greater control over how dropdown menus visually interact with the rest of the page.

  2. Improved hover detection on hybrid devices
    Interaction events have been refined for devices that support both touch and mouse input, resulting in smoother and more predictable menu behavior.

  3. Removed stagger effect when animation is set to “none”
    When animation is disabled, the menu now appears instantly without unnecessary transition delays.


🛠 Fixes

  • Fixed Mega Menu width reset issue that could occur in certain layouts.
  • Fixed Video Background script issue where the background video would not initialize correctly.

🔐 Security Improvements

Fixing security vulnerabilities at the AJAX endpoint

Security is always a top priority. In version 3.3.11, we’ve addressed vulnerabilities related to the AJAX endpoint to ensure safer communication and stronger protection for your Joomla websites. We strongly recommend updating to this version to benefit from the latest security enhancements.


🎬 GSAP Updated to 3.14.2

We’ve upgraded GSAP from 3.13.0 to 3.14.2, bringing improved performance, better stability, and compatibility with the latest animation features.

This ensures smoother animations, better browser support, and a more future-proof foundation for interactive UI elements across your site.


🧭 Mega Menu Fully Rewritten

The Mega Menu system has been completely rewritten.

This rewrite delivers:

  • Cleaner and more maintainable code structure
  • Improved animation handling
  • Better performance and responsiveness
  • Enhanced flexibility for complex submenu layouts

Whether you’re building simple dropdowns or advanced multi-column mega menus, the new system provides a more reliable and scalable foundation.


🎨 Color Transform Code Rewritten

We’ve also rewritten the Color Transform engine, improving how colors are processed and applied across the framework.

Benefits include:

  • More accurate color manipulation
  • Improved consistency across components
  • Cleaner internal architecture
  • Better maintainability for future enhancements

This update strengthens Astroid’s dynamic styling capabilities while keeping performance optimized.

🚀 Astroid Framework 3.3.10 Released

We’re pleased to announce the release of Astroid Framework v3.3.10, a maintenance update focused on improving compatibility and preventing critical server errors across supported PHP environments.

This update resolves an issue that could trigger 500 Internal Server Errors when running Astroid on PHP 8.2, PHP 8.3, and versions lower than PHP 8.4 — ensuring more stable performance and a smoother experience for developers and site owners.

🔧 Changelog — Astroid 3.3.10

  • Fixed an issue that could raise 500 errors when using PHP 8.2, PHP 8.3, or PHP versions lower than 8.4.

Astroid v3.3.8 Released 🎉

We are pleased to announce the official release of Astroid Framework v3.3.8. This update focuses on bug fixes, stability improvements, and better compatibility with Joomla 6, ensuring a smoother and more reliable development experience.

🔧 What’s New in Astroid v3.3.8

  • Fixed an issue with reading large JSON data
    Resolved a bug that prevented large JSON files from being read correctly on certain server environments.
  • Fixed param is null issue in Article Layout
    Addressed an issue where null parameters could cause errors or unexpected behavior in article layouts.
  • Improved the SaveLayout function
    Enhanced the reliability and performance of the layout saving process.
  • Fixed deprecated warnings for Joomla 6
    Updated deprecated code to ensure better compatibility and future readiness for Joomla 6.

🚀 Astroid 3.3.6 Release Announcement

We are pleased to announce the official release of Astroid Framework version 3.3.6.

This release focuses on improving user experience, refining the UI, and fixing reported issues, helping ensure a smoother and more stable workflow for both site builders and developers using Astroid with Joomla.

Special thanks to @linuxpac, @lichtmetzger, @Maedchengestalter, @Banuk1616, @iorbita, @WM-Loose and @Mai-Lapyst for their valuable support in bringing this version to life.

✨ Highlights of Astroid 3.3.6

  • Enhanced UI/UX across key configuration areas
  • Improved stability and consistency in Layout Builder and Form Builder
  • Bug fixes based on community feedback
  • Better handling of visual effects, borders, and fonts

🔄 Improvements

  • Updated UX of Layout Builder: A smoother and more intuitive layout-building experience.
  • Improved Pre-loader effect: More polished and optimized loading animations.
  • Improved Border Style: Enhanced border styling options and visual consistency.
  • Improved UI/UX of Template Options – Layout Tab: Clearer structure and better usability when configuring layouts.

🐞 Bug Fixes

  • Fixed issue with incorrect Dynamic value types: Ensures dynamic values are handled correctly.
  • Fixed issue where Color Transform on scroll was not disabled when selecting Light or Dark Mode (#1337).
  • Fixed issue where the “Form Builder” widget did not work in Article Layout (#1336).
  • Fixed issue where Form Builder did not work in Module Layout Builder.
  • Fixed issue where local font handling created junk files in /tmp.

🚀 Astroid Framework v3.3.5 is here!

This latest release brings a series of exciting enhancements and refinements to elevate your Joomla website-building experience.
Special thanks to @WM-Loose, @patrickus33, @deltapapa01 and @matrix630307 for their valuable support in bringing this version to life.

✨ What’s New:

  • Added Text Font Style options to the Button Widget.
  • Improved Blog Image Bottom style for a cleaner layout.
  • Introduced Typography settings for Text and Title Article Widget.
  • Added an option to enable/disable titles in the Image Carousel Widget.
  • Enhanced Astroid Layouts UI for a smoother design workflow.
  • Added Import/Export functionality for Sub-layouts.
  • Improved language file loading in Manage App.
  • Optimized Sticky Background style within Astroid Box Layout.
  • Updated and refined Astroid Field names for better clarity.
